Output d3276de4cce046d1644204201f000957c378ab8145a8dc8378ef0ad60bdc99e3:22

value
43046721
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6d7128283bde414d8e9b4999c13b756a3e8792c2f7a9429ca0cd0169d5b0d3d8
address
bc1pd4cjs2pmmeq5mr5mfxvuzwm4dglg0ykz7755989qe5qkn4ds60vq3w2s55
transaction
d3276de4cce046d1644204201f000957c378ab8145a8dc8378ef0ad60bdc99e3
confirmations
79996
spent
true